What Famous Architect Would You Want To Meet?

Styleture.com asked folks that question, and surprise, surprise, Frank Lloyd Wright got more votes than anyone else.  I suppose he'd be on my list also (along with Gaudi, Mies and Louis Sullivan), but I'd also want to know more about some of the architects who brought us Dallas landmarks,  Nicholas Clayton (Cathedral). Lang & Witchell (Booker T. Washington High School, the original Hilton and the Sear warehouse among others).  And residential designers of yesteryear like Anton Korn.  And of course George Dahl, mastermind of Fair Park.  Here’s Styleture’s full list.  Who’s on yours?

While you ponder that, take a gander at Slate.com’s list of architectural failures.  Interestingly enough, Wright makes this list also…with one of his most iconic works.
